Home
last modified time | relevance | path

Searched refs:uioap (Results 1 – 2 of 2) sorted by relevance

/titanic_41/usr/src/uts/common/os/
H A Dmove.c577 uioainit(uio_t *uiop, uioa_t *uioap) in uioainit() argument
587 uioa_page_t *locked = uioap->uioa_locked; in uioainit()
591 if (! (uioap->uioa_state & UIOA_ALLOC)) { in uioainit()
607 uioap->uioa_hwst[UIO_DCOPY_CHANNEL] = channel; in uioainit()
608 uioap->uioa_hwst[UIO_DCOPY_CMD] = NULL; in uioainit()
611 uioap->uioa_state = UIOA_INIT; in uioainit()
613 uioap->uioa_mbytes = 0; in uioainit()
616 *((uio_t *)uioap) = *uiop; in uioainit()
623 uioap->uio_iov = iov; in uioainit()
624 uioap->uio_iovcnt = iovcnt; in uioainit()
[all …]
/titanic_41/usr/src/uts/common/fs/sockfs/
H A Dsodirect.c153 uioa_t *uioap = &sodp->sod_uioa; in sod_uioa_mblk_init() local
160 if (uioap->uioa_state & UIOA_ENABLED) { in sod_uioa_mblk_init()
163 if (msg_size > uioap->uio_resid) { in sod_uioa_mblk_init()
170 uioap->uioa_state &= UIOA_CLR; in sod_uioa_mblk_init()
171 uioap->uioa_state |= UIOA_FINI; in sod_uioa_mblk_init()
177 if (!uioamove(mp1->b_rptr, len, UIO_READ, uioap)) { in sod_uioa_mblk_init()
182 uioap->uioa_state &= UIOA_CLR; in sod_uioa_mblk_init()
183 uioap->uioa_state |= UIOA_FINI; in sod_uioa_mblk_init()
189 if (mp1 != NULL || uioap->uio_resid == 0) { in sod_uioa_mblk_init()
258 uioa_t *uioap = (uioa_t *)uiop; in sod_uioa_so_init() local
[all …]